
(CNN) - The White House's so-called "money-hunk" is engaged.
Office of Management and Budget Director Peter Orszag is set to marry ABC News correspondent Bianna Golodryga, Golodryga announced on ABC's Good Morning America Tuesday.
The couple first met at the White House Correspondents Dinner last May, and the man who White House Chief of Staff Rahm Emanuel once said "made nerdy sexy" soon won Golodryga's heart.
"[He's] tall, dark and he could say Golodryga and spell it after our first date. That is a winner in my book," she said.
The 31-year-old Golodryga, has worked for ABC since 2007 and mainly reports on business issues. Orszag, 41, is the former director of the Congressional Budget Office and a former veteran of the Clinton administration.
